Maryland Statutes

§ 9-903

Maryland·Article gab Alcoholic Beverages and Cannabis·Title 9
(a)There is a Class C beer, wine, and liquor license.
(b)The license authorizes the license holder to sell beer, wine, and liquor at retail at a club, at the place described in the license, for on– or off–premises consumption.
(c)The annual license fee is $500.
